Ralston Mclean


Many childcare specialists and child education and learning specialists agree that moms and dads need to be stressed over the video game their kids play. Visit here: https://www.papygeek.com/software/bumptop-le-bureau-virtuel-au-dela-du-reel/ for details.


Recent Videos by Ralston Mclean

Recent Images by Ralston Mclean


Ralston Mclean's Guestbook

Login to post a comment. You can sign up for a free account if you don't have one yet.


Recent Actions

Profile Updated 4 days ago
Uploaded a new image 1 month ago
Profile Updated 1 month ago
Logged in 1 month ago
Profile Updated 1 month ago
Register 1 month ago